<h3>What is a compound sentence?</h3>
A sentence which is made by joining or merging two or more sentences is known as a compound sentence. Conjunctions are used to create or make such compound sentences.
They contain data or information about two elements which are related to each other and hence, it becomes easy to merge such sentences.
